All they need to do is register at an authorised M-PESA Agent by providing their Safaricom mobile number and their identification card. Once registered, customers can:<br /><br /> * Put money into their account by depositing cash at a local Agent<br /> * Send money to other mobile phone users by SMS instruction, even if they are not Safaricom subscribers.<br /> * Withdraw cash at local a Agent<br /> * Buy Safaricom airtime for themselves or other subscribers<br /><br />Safaricom, the leading mobile communications provider in Kenya, is pleased to announce the launch of M-PESA, an innovative new mobile payment solution that enables customers to complete simple financial transactions by mobile phone. M-PESA has been developed by Vodafone, the world's leading mobile telecommunications group, with the pilot in Kenya operated by Safaricom.Gerald Shumahttp://www.blogger.com/profile/12684981920616843056no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-7577005943650946979.post-56212801258870157642007-08-03T07:39:00.000-04:002007-08-03T08:24:00.113-04:00Life is more enjoyable with perks.<a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://www.eperks.com/images/logo_beta_160x80.gif"><img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er; width: 142px; height: 71px;" src="http://www.eperks.com/images/logo_beta_160x80.gif" alt="" border="0" /></a><br /><br /><br /><br /><br /><br />Life is more enjoyable with perks.<br /><br /><br /><br /><br /><a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://momb.socio-kybernetics.net/images/529.gif"><img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er; width: 320px;" src="http://momb.socio-kybernetics.net/images/529.gif" alt="" border="0" /></a>Gerald Shumahttp://www.blogger.com/profile/12684981920616843056no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-7577005943650946979.post-54955747000390659892007-08-02T07:43:00.000-04:002007-08-02T07:47:19.192-04:00MySidekick : a social search engine that learns from you and gets smarter as you search.<a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://www.mysidekick.com/img/txt-sm-mysidekick.jpg"><img style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; float: left; cursor: pointer; width: 212px; height: 41px;" src="http://www.mysidekick.com/img/txt-sm-mysidekick.jpg" alt="" border="0" /></a><br /><br /><br /><p> MySidekick is a social search engine that learns from you and gets smarter as you search. Thanks to RSS, our lives have been ever so simplified.<br /><br />OPML has been the typical approach to combining all RSS feeds into a single file that can be exported and imported into any feed reader. Then along comes <a href="http://rssmixer.com/">RSS Mixer</a>. This online tool lets users combine all favorite feeds into one. The drawback to using this is that you cannot simply upload an OPML file, you have to add multiple feeds. But if you have a few feeds that you wanted to follow no matter where you are, like via a mobile device like an iPhone or a widget embedded in your iGoogle homepage, this is a cool way to go. Users start off by giving a title to their 'Mix', then adding feed URL's into the Mix. When RSS Mixer is complete, users get the option to link to the mix, create an Apple Dashboard widget, create a Web Widget, get an RSS feed for the combined feeds, and launch an iPhone version of the mix.<br /><br />It's a pretty impressive way to easily mix up RSS feeds, and stay on top of them no matter where you are. Our only wish, give us the chance to upload an OPML file.Gerald Shumahttp://www.blogger.com/profile/12684981920616843056no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-7577005943650946979.post-29256013552255079352007-07-27T07:03:00.000-04:002007-07-27T08:39:32.658-04:00A place for people to share their lives, commenting on, and viewing photos and videos.<a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://www.matez.net/Default.aspx"><img style="cursor: pointer; width: 201px; height: 62px;" src="http://www.matez.net/images/Matez.png" alt="" border="0" /></a><br /><br /><a href="http://www.matez.net/Default.aspx">Matez </a>is a place for people to share their lives, commenting on, and viewing photos and videos.<br /><br />With <a href="http://www.matez.net/Default.aspx">Matez</a>, people can:<br /><br />Upload, tag and share videos worldwide<br />Browse photos,videos uploaded by community members<br />Find, join and create video groups to connect with people who have similar interests<br />Customize the experience by subscribing to member videos, saving favorites, and creating playlists<br />Integrate Matez videos on websites using video embeds or APIs<br />Make videos public or private—users can elect to broadcast their videos publicly or share them privately with friends and family upon upload.<br /><br /><a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://bp2.blogger.com/_3aFCHZAmYkI/Re46Pl8UnwI/AAAAAAAAAdI/gUx4ZFotXZc/s1600-h/matez.jpg"><img style="cursor: pointer;" src="http://bp2.blogger.com/_3aFCHZAmYkI/Re46Pl8UnwI/AAAAAAAAAdI/gUx4ZFotXZc/s320/matez.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5039029072631734018" border="0" /></a><br /><br />Matez is building a community that is highly motivated to watch and share videos. Many of these have been around for years, and some have been very successful. Here is a look at 10 of the most profitable copycats so far.</p> <p><a href="http://www.studivz.net/">StudiVZ</a></p> <p>A Facebook clone for the German market, the founders of StudiVZ have already <a href="http://mashable.com/2007/01/03/studivz/">sold the site for more than $100 million</a>. StudiVZ is nearly identical to Facebook in terms of features, functionality, and interface. </p> <p><img src="http://www.mashable.com/images/studivzshot.png"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.xiaonei.com/">Xiaonei</a></p> <p>The largest Facebook clone in China, Xiaonei sold to Oak Pacific Interactive, a Chinese Internet conglomerate, and was merged with another social network called 5Q.</p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/xiaonei.gif"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.vkontakte.ru/">vkontakte.ru</a></p> <p>The Russian Facebook makes no attempt to hide the fact that it’s a clone; Vkontakte.ru almost exactly resembles Facebook’s design. Russia is also home to <a href="http://www.rutube.ru/">rutube.ru</a>, a popular YouTube clone. Maybe a sign that existing social networks aren’t releasing Russian versions fast enough? </p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/russia.gif"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.desimartini.com/">DesiMartini</a> </p> <p>This Facebook clone is designed for India, and prominently features familiar Facebook features such as profiles, friends, groups, and classifieds. Ironically, the site features an embedded YouTube video on the homepage. </p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/desimartini.gif"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.studentsn.com/">studentSN</a></p> <p>Student Social Network is a Facebook clone available in four different countries – Turkey, Russia, Germany, and Great Britain. Its success appears to have been limited, however. </p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/studentdn.gif"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.schuelerregister.de/">Schuelerregister.de</a></p> <p>The name roughly translates to the “Pupil Register”, and Schuelerregister.de is another German attempt to copy Facebook. The site is said to be getting a little traction, at least according to Alexa where it has had a 5-digit rank recently.</p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/register.gif"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.feierabend.de/">Feierabend.de</a></p> <p>This German clone appears to be more intended for the 50+ set, but is worth noting as it claims more than 100,000 users. </p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/feierabend.gif"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.schueler.cc/">Schueler</a> </p> <p>Schueler.cc (your “community center”) is yet another German attempt at cloning Facebook, claiming more than 30,000 schools as part of its network. They have changed the look and feel a bit, but it’s still built around academic and regional networks.</p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/schueler.gif"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.studentface.com.au/">StudentFace</a> </p> <p>Drawing inspiration in both features and name, StudentFace is a social network for the Australian market. They have added a feature similar to Facebook’s News Feed, allowing you “to see which one of your friends have updated their profiles and/or added friends.”</p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/studentface.gif" /></p> <p><a href="http://www.qiraz.com/">Qiraz</a> </p> <p>Last but not least, this Turkish Facebook clone also targets student networks. Google Translate wasn’t much help on this one, but the design is clearly Facebook-inspired. </p> <p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/qiraz.gif" /></p> <p>If imitation is the sincerest form of flattery, Facebook must be blushing beat red. At this point, most of the clones will have trouble keeping up with Facebook’s rapid feature rollout, but that won’t stop them from trying to bring the basic model of collegiate and regional networks to their home countries. Those who do it well (Xiaonei, StudiVZ) have proven that a well-done copycat can not only be popular, but a viable means to getting rich quickly.</p>Gerald Shumahttp://www.blogger.com/profile/12684981920616843056no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-7577005943650946979.post-42240315025506413582007-07-12T08:10:00.000-04:002007-07-12T08:11:43.163-04:00Feedburner Comes to Blogger.<p><img src="http://mashable.com/wp-content/uploads/2007/07/fblogger.PNG" alt="fblogger.PNG" /></p> <p>It was inevitable really: Feedburner’s new owner Google has gone ahead and integrated the feed tracking service into its Blogspot/<a href="http://www.blogger.com">Blogger.com</a> blog platform, enabling one click redirection of Blogger feeds to Feedburner. </p> <p>In other words: if you want detailed stats on who is reading your Blogger blog, it’s now easy to do.
